Pictures used in the digipak
These pictures were taken on the same day we wrapped up filming. This is because I felt that the location we were at had the perfect atmosphere for what I was trying to portray. Additionally, I chose a faceless picture to represent that this EP features songs about parts of Marc that he usually hides, hence, why he's hiding his face. The sunset added a pop of color and I tweaked the color scheme in Photoshop to ensure it matches the vibe of the rest of the panels. I also used a still from the video for one of my panels

Codes and conventions of a digipak
As part of my research, I decided to familiarize myself with the codes and conventions of a digipak. Here’s a quick breakdown of the main conventions:
-
Front Cover: A strong image, artist name, and album title that capture the mood and vibe of the music.
-
Back Cover: Tracklist, barcode, credits, and visuals that match the overall style.
-
Inside Panels: Extra artwork, lyrics, or thank-you notes, plus a custom design for the CD itself.
-
Visual Style: Consistent colors, fonts, and imagery that reflect the emotion of the album and appeal to the target audience.
I want the digipak to feel personal and emotional, just like the music video. Almost like flipping through an old photo album.
The colors, fonts, and images will all reflect the themes of healing, growth, and finding peace.

Post production-color grading
Once I was satisfied with how the video turned out, I moved on to the next stage, which was color grading. YouTube was such a big help when it came to this process, allowing me to create an atmosphere that was desirable to me.
I wanted my color grading to be similar to that of the Peach music video by Kevin Abstract so I focused on making it have that warm, vintage and nostalgic look with vibrant colors for the flashback scenes and contrast this with cool color palettes for the present day(bedroom) scenes
